ENSEMBLE BAGGING WITH ORDINAL LOGISTIC REGRESSION TO CLASSIFY TODDLER NUTRITIONAL STATUS
One problem in classifying stunting data is that the data used does not have a balanced proportion. This study aims to apply the logistic regression classification method with ordinal scale response variables to overcome class imbalance through the ensemble bagging approach.
